The Impact of Substance Abuse in Cookeville & Putnam County

Cookeville, Tennessee, is a vibrant and growing town known for its small-town charm, strong sense of community, and central role in the Upper Cumberland region.

It’s home to Tennessee Tech University, a major driver of local activity.

It serves as a healthcare and economic hub for surrounding counties, but like many areas in Tennessee, Cookeville and greater Putnam County are seeing the effects of rising substance use.

Opioid misuse remains a leading concern in this region.

According to the Tennessee Department of Health, Putnam County has seen consistent increases in opioid-related overdoses, including those involving fentanyl and oxycodone. Emergency responders in Cookeville regularly report calls involving nonfatal overdoses, and local hospitals continue to treat patients for opioid complications at high rates.

Alcohol-related incidents—ranging from DUI arrests to emergency room visits—are also common, especially among younger adults and college students.

Stimulant use, including methamphetamine and prescription ADHD medications like Adderall, has become more visible. At the same time, benzodiazepine misuse (such as Xanax and Klonopin) has quietly risen, often in combination with opioids—making the risk of overdose even greater.

The impact isn’t just medical. Schools report more behavioral issues related to substance use at home, workplaces struggle with absenteeism and safety concerns, and families across Cookeville are left feeling helpless.

While the area offers some outpatient services and basic treatment options, there is a clear lack of comprehensive care—particularly for people with both addiction and underlying mental health conditions.

    Support groups in Cookeville play an important role in helping individuals and families cope with addiction. 

    While formal rehab services may be limited locally, peer-led recovery programs offer valuable emotional support and community connection.

    AA & NA Meetings:

    Alcoholics Anonymous (AA) and Narcotics Anonymous (NA) provide free, peer-run meetings for those recovering from alcohol and drug use. 

    These 12-step programs focus on personal accountability, shared experience, and mutual support in a non-judgmental setting. Meetings typically include open discussions, step readings, and speaker sessions.

    Cookeville hosts several AA and NA meetings weekly. Up-to-date local listings are available through AA in Tennessee and NA Tennessee Region.

    Al-Anon & Nar-Anon:

    These groups are specifically for family members and friends affected by someone else’s addiction. 

    Meetings offer a safe, structured space to process feelings, learn healthy boundaries, and connect with others facing similar challenges. 

    Local meetings can be found on the Al-Anon Family Groups website and Nar-Anon website.

    Celebrate Recovery:

    Several Cookeville churches, including Life Church and Washington Avenue Baptist, host Celebrate Recovery—a Christ-centered 12-step program open to individuals struggling with addiction, codependency, or other life issues. 

    Meetings typically include worship, teachings, and small-group discussions.

    Veteran Support:

    Veterans in the Cookeville area can access specialized addiction and mental health support through the Cookeville VA Clinic and Upper Cumberland Area Veterans Services, which offer referrals to trauma-informed care, peer groups, and case management.

    Community Awareness Efforts:

    Cookeville participates in community-wide drug take-back days, often in partnership with the sheriff’s department and local pharmacies. Local Recovery Resources in Cookeville

Cookeville residents looking for help with substance use and mental health challenges have access to several local and state-supported resources. However, most are limited to early intervention, education, and referrals.

The Tennessee Department of Mental Health and Substance Abuse Services (TDMHSAS) offers prevention services, educational outreach, and treatment referrals through regional programs. They work with local organizations to distribute information, train first responders, and connect individuals to licensed treatment providers across the state.

The Putnam County Health Department also plays a role in addressing addiction locally. They run health education campaigns, promote safe medication disposal, and offer harm reduction services, including naloxone distribution and HIV/hepatitis testing. While they don’t provide rehab services, they can guide residents toward available support.

Some local nonprofits, such as Power of Putnam, focus on youth drug prevention and substance abuse education in schools. 

They partner with law enforcement, educators, and families to increase awareness and reduce the stigma surrounding addiction.

For immediate support, Cookeville residents can call the Tennessee REDLINE (1-800-889-9789) or the SAMHSA National Helpline (1-800-662-HELP) for 24/7 confidential assistance. Local mental health crisis lines are also available through regional providers like Volunteer Behavioral Health.

Several area churches and schools offer peer support groups and hold awareness events that focus on substance abuse prevention, especially for teens and families.
